Gibson Non-Reverse Thunderbird, Faded Pelham Blue
The 1960s brought musical instrument innovation on a massive scale, but few guitars from the era stand out like 1965’s funky and futuristic Non-Reverse Thunderbird. Highly sought after for generations, today’s players now can rock along endlessly with this model – the Gibson USA Non-Reverse Thunderbird. This beauty of a bass features all the vintage stylings and tones that made the originals so adored and coveted. Starting off with a Non-Reverse mahogany body, mahogany neck, and rosewood fingerboard, the shape and length of this bass fit seamlessly into any bassist’s arms. The two unique Thunderbird pickups produce plenty of thumping tone and smooth groove and each have a dedicated volume control to roll through a spectrum of tones. The hardware and appointments this bass has make it a truly solid and stylish instrument. A three-point adjustable bridge and Hipshot Ultralight tuners keep intonation steady and adjustable while a three-ply white pickguard bearing the Thunderbird graphic makes the finish pop. - Thunderbird Non-Reverse mahogany body
- Mahogany neck in a Rounded profile
- Indian rosewood fingerboard with twenty Medium Jumbo frets
- Two Gibson Thunderbird pickups with individual volume controls
- Three-point adjustable bridge with chrome finish
- Hipshot Ultralite tuners with chrome plating
- Graph Tech nut
- Gloss nitrocellulose lacquer body finish
- Gibson hardshell case included
